Some solid lists.

id say the biggest debate is Brady. 

quite the short stint but his impact on and off the field cannot be understated. He changed the organization forever in his what, 3 years? Is it crazy to put him at 1? Even players like gronk Antonio brown same thing. Top 10 worthy? Probably not but both very impactful in a short term as well.

im biased towards Dunn, he’s the reason I’m a fan. My psn is Bucs55Brooks so he’s gotta be in my top 3.

from the first sb team certainly barber brooks lynch rice is close, shame both him and David will never sniff canton. Both deserve it. David has 1 pro bowl but 3 all pros. Not many can say they have more all pros than pro bowls, but the pb is and has always been just a popularity contest anyway.

alstott arguably the best fb of all time and just fun as hell to watch.

He was steady & consistent, and pretty special to watch. Just as the team was starting to peak, his career ended due to an injury.

I would agree that Tristan certainly looks to be a better athlete, and has potential to play for a long time. I didn’t rank Gruber in my top 10, I just had him in my honorable mention’s due to his consistency & great play over a long tough period.

Hard to watch a guy like Gruber work so hard for 11 years (never missing a snap for his first 5 years), for one of the worst owners and teams in the franchise’s history - not get at least get a mention.

Tristan has been fantastic for the last 4 years. Tristan pick was rockstar level, but he’s played for some Super teams and some good teams - and he fits with the talent around him.

Pretty sure he makes the Mount Rushmore list in the next few years.

Hard to understate how dysfunctional the Bucs were around the time we drafted Gruber. 

in those years we drafted never-to-Buc Bo Jackson, traded away Steve Young and drafted Vinny T, which made Gruber the obvious choice.
